The Halloween pageant's theme was not along its usual lines (witches, ghosts, etc...) but that year it was to show the diversity of agricultural products from the region. This is why Scout was attributed the "role"...
The grown ups hide all of the sisters' furniture in the basement is the practical joke that persuaded the grown ups to have an organized event in 'To Kill a Mockingbird'. The grown ups then decide to have a Halloween Pageant instead of having the kids go 'Trick or Treating'.
